web-dev-qa-db-fra.com

apt-build et Chrome PPA

Je voudrais créer une version (optimisée) de Chromium pour ma machine avec apt-build sur Ubuntu 10.04. J'ai ajouté un Chromium-PPA à mon /etc/sources.list.d/ comme ceci:

deb http://ppa.launchpad.net/chromium-daily/stable/ubuntu lucid main
deb-src http://ppa.launchpad.net/chromium-daily/stable/ubuntulucid main

Mais si je cours

Sudo apt-build install chromium browser

Ça me dit

chromium-browser ne sera pas construit car il n'a pas de paquet source. Nom de package source manquant pour source_by_source ().

D'autre part Sudo apt-get source chrome-browser

semble bien fonctionner, télécharge même le 6.x à partir du PPA

Qu'est-ce que je fais mal? Construire ffmpeg et firefox via apt-build a fonctionné comme un jeu d'enfant. Sauf que mon chrome préféré provient d'un PPA, je ne vois pas de différence.

2
bobbydroptables

Oui, la ligne avec le "ubuntulucid" est une faute de frappe, l'original a ces deux séparés.

@sagarchalise: C'est exactement comment j'ai installé Chromium et cela fonctionne. Cependant, je voudrais le faire construire par apt-build au lieu d'installer la version binaire avec apt-get. Donc ça ne marche pas pour moi. L'ajout du référentiel n'a pas fonctionné pour moi non plus.

[~ # ~] modifier [~ # ~]

Résolu! On dirait que apt-build a besoin tous les dépôts deb-src qu'il devrait utiliser à l'intérieur /etc/apt/sources.list . En ajoutant le PPA via apt-add-repository un fichier séparé pour chaque nouveau référentiel est créé (à l'intérieur de /etc/apt/sources.list.d) . Donc, mettre les deux lignes directement dans /etc/sources.list et exécuter

Sudo apt-build update && Sudo apt-build --reinstall install chrome-browser

résolu le problème pour moi. Merci pour vos idées quand même!

EDIT²

Ce rapport de bogue sur le tableau de bord semble lié.

2
baccus

Essaye ça

Sudo add-apt-repository ppa:chromium-daily/stable && Sudo apt-get update && Sudo apt-get install chromium-browser

Quant à votre fichier sources.list.d, donnez un espace en plus d'ubuntu et lucid comme ceci "/ ubuntu lucid main" si le même est dans votre source et ce n'est pas une faute de frappe :)

0
sagarchalise